A dual diagnosis is a diagnosis of a co-occurring addiction and mental health disorder. This could be an occurrence of both a drug and alcohol addiction along with an anxiety disorder, or a gambling addiction combined with clinical depression. It could be several things all occurring simultaneously, with particular disorders making other issues worse or even triggering them. For instance, someone's alcohol abuse might be stimulated by their need to self-medicate because of their anxiety or depression. Someone might be struggling with depression because of their substance use. It often requires specialists to ascertain the root causes of each of the issues the person is struggling with and work out a treatment plan that will effectively address both concurrently so that the person can live a sober and psychologically healthy life.
